visualbbasic
06/16/2017, 5:56 AMimport Relay from 'react-relay'
export default class UpdatePokemonMutation extends Relay.Mutation {
getMutation () {
return Relay.QL`mutation{updatePokemon}`
}
getFatQuery () {
return Relay.QL`
fragment on UpdatePokemonPayload {
pokemon
edge
viewer {
allPokemons
}
}
`
}
getConfigs () {
return [
{
type: 'FIELDS_CHANGE',
fieldIDs: {
pokemon: this.props.pokemon
},
},
]
}
getVariables () {
return {
name: this.props.name,
url: this.props.url,
}
}
getOptimisticResponse () {
}
}
that's my fields_change mutation